import numpy as np
from scipy.constants import physical_constants
from scipy.special import logsumexp
from py_sc_fermi.defect_charge_state import DefectChargeState
[docs]
class DefectSpecies:
"""Class for individual defect species.
Args:
name (str): A unique identifying string for this defect species,
e.g. ``"V_O"`` might be used for an oxygen vacancy.
nsites (int): Number of sites energetically degenerate sites where this
defect can form in the unit cell (the site degeneracy).
charge_states (dict[int, DefectChargeState]): A dictionary of
``DefectChargeState`` with their charge as the key, i.e.
{charge : ``DefectChargeState``}
"""
def __init__(
self,
name: str,
nsites: int,
charge_states: dict[int, DefectChargeState],
fixed_concentration: float | None = None,
):
"""Instantiate a DefectSpecies object."""
self._name = name
self._nsites = nsites
self._charge_states = charge_states
self._fixed_concentration = fixed_concentration

def tl_profile(self, efermi_min: float, efermi_max: float) -> np.ndarray:
"""get transition level profile for this ``DefectSpecies`` between a
minimum and maximum Fermi energy.
Args:
efermi_min (float): minimum Fermi energy
efermi_max (float): maximum Fermi energy
Returns:
np.ndarray: transition level profile between efermi_min
and efermi_max.
"""
cs = self.min_energy_charge_state(efermi_min)
q1 = cs.charge
form_e = cs.get_formation_energy(efermi_min)
points = [(efermi_min, form_e)]
while q1 != min(self.charges):
qlist = [q for q in self.charges if q < q1]
nextp, nextq = min(
((self.get_transition_level_and_energy(q1, q2), q2) for q2 in qlist),
key=lambda p: p[0][0],
)
if nextp[0] < efermi_max:
points.append(nextp)
q1 = nextq
else:
break
cs = self.min_energy_charge_state(efermi_max)
form_e = cs.get_formation_energy(efermi_max)
points.append((efermi_max, form_e))
return np.array(points)
[docs]
def get_transition_level_and_energy(self, q1: int, q2: int) -> tuple[float, float]:
"""Calculates the Fermi energy and formation
energy for the transition level between charge states q1 and q2.
Args:
q1 (int): charge on first ``DefectChargeState`` of interest
q2 (int): charge on second ``DefectChargeState`` of interest
Returns:
tuple[float, float]: Fermi energy and formation energy of the
transition level between ``DefectChargeState`` objects with charges
q1 and q2.
"""
form_eners = self.get_formation_energies(0)
trans_level = (form_eners[q2] - form_eners[q1]) / (q1 - q2)
energy = q1 * trans_level + form_eners[q1]
return (trans_level, energy)

def charge_state_concentrations(
self, e_fermi: float, temperature: float
) -> dict[int, float]:
"""Calculate the concentrations of the different charge states.
At a given Fermi energy and temperature, calculate the concentrations
of the different ``DefectChargeStates`` of this ``DefectSpecies``.
If the species has a fixed total concentration, the variable charge
state concentrations are distributed according to their Boltzmann
weights using a numerically stable logsumexp calculation.
Args:
e_fermi (float): Fermi energy
temperature (float): temperature
Returns:
dict[int, float]: key-value pairs of charge of each
``DefectChargeState`` and the concentration of the
``DefectChargeState`` with that charge, i.e.
{``DefectChargeState.charge``: concentration}
Raises:
ValueError: If fixed charge state concentrations exceed the
total species concentration.
"""
kboltz = physical_constants["Boltzmann constant in eV/K"][0]
var_concs = self.variable_conc_charge_states()
fixed_concs = self.fixed_conc_charge_states()
cs_concentrations = {}
# Fixed concentration charge states
for q, cs in fixed_concs.items():
cs_concentrations[q] = cs.get_concentration(e_fermi, temperature)
if self.fixed_concentration is not None and var_concs:
# Species has fixed total concentration
# Use logsumexp for numerically stable proportions
fixed_conc_total = sum(cs_concentrations.values())
constrained_conc = self.fixed_concentration - fixed_conc_total
if constrained_conc < 0:
raise ValueError(
f"Fixed charge state concentrations ({fixed_conc_total}) exceed "
f"total species concentration ({self.fixed_concentration})"
)
# Calculate log Boltzmann weights
log_weights = {
q: np.log(cs.degeneracy) - cs.get_formation_energy(e_fermi) / (kboltz * temperature)
for q, cs in var_concs.items()
}
# Stable proportions via logsumexp
log_weight_values = np.array(list(log_weights.values()))
log_total = logsumexp(log_weight_values)
# Distribute constrained concentration according to proportions
for q, log_w in log_weights.items():
proportion = np.exp(log_w - log_total)
cs_concentrations[q] = proportion * constrained_conc
else:
# No fixed species concentration - standard calculation
for cs in var_concs.values():
cs_concentrations[cs.charge] = (
cs.get_concentration(e_fermi, temperature) * self.nsites
)
return cs_concentrations
